Webb6 sep. 2014 · This new formula, emphasizing the way we may be supposed to have acquired our subjection to moral requirements, is called the formula of autonomy. It says that we are subject to the requirement of our maxims’ conformity to universal law through our own free will. There is a long tradition of focusing on Kant's formula of universal law as a principle for evaluating maxims, resting … recycling borehamwoodWebbThe Categorical Imperative is supposed to provide a way for us to evaluate moral actions and to make moral judgments. It is not a command to perform specific actions -- it does not say, "follow the 10 commandments", or "respect your elders".
